HomeMy WebLinkAbout1244 - ADMIN Ordinance - City Council - 1973/09/24ORIGINAL SEPTEMBER 17, 1973 5C ORDINANCE NO. 6n. 44 AN ORDINANCE AMENDING ORDINANCE NO. 730 PASSED DECEMBER 28, 1959 ENTITLED "ST. LOUIS PARK ZONING ORDINANCE" BY AMENDING SECTION 6:032 RULES AND DEFINITIONS AND SECTION 6:122 USES PY SPECIAL PERMIT THE CITY OF ST. LOUIS PARK DOES ORDAIN: Section 1. That Section 6:032 is hereby amended by adding: Section 6:032.58. Hotel -Apartment: A Hotel in which up to 257, of the total units may be used for dwelling purposes Section 2. That Section 6:122 is hereby amended by adding: Section 6:122.16. Hotel -Apartment provided no more than 25% of the units are apartments. Section 3. That this ordinance shall take effect fifteen days after its publication.
